It has been 8-months since the controversial fight between Ryan Garcia and Devin Haney at the Barclays Center, in Brooklyn. Garcia defeated the former WBC super lightweight champion via the majority decision to secure an emphatic victory. However, the New York State Athletic Commission later overturned the fight to a no-contest as Garcia tested positive for Ostarine and Devin Haney got his undefeated record reinstated.
Nevertheless, the fact that it was a humbling experience for Devin Haney remains. Garcia dropped the former undisputed lightweight champion three times during the bout. Furthermore, rumors of the San Francisco native suffering a broken jaw also went viral after the match. Haney outright declined the rumors, claiming that he was fine and was proud of his performance.
He took to his ‘X’ and wrote, “I have no broken anything btw way like i said im Ok,” assuring the fans that he would be back. However, it has been 8-months and we have not seen Haney back in action. Is Coach Kenny Ellis switching sides again?
Even though Devin Haney boasts an undefeated record, he was surely low on confidence after facing Ryan Garcia. That is why, a few months after the match, he joined hands with Gervonta Davis’ co-trainer Kenny Ellis. It was an unlikely alliance but was justified, as ‘The Dream’ needed a change in his support team.
However, almost five months after this new partnership started, Ellis gave a new update regarding Devin Haney’s physical health in a rather cryptic message. He took to his Instagram story and wrote, “A friend of mine got his jaw broken once during a boxing match. He wanted to get back in the gym as soon as possible, but do to the severity of the fracture he had to take a year off before any full contact. But in some cases you can get back to full contact in two of three months depending on the fracture and where the fracture is located on the jaw.”
While the message did not mention Devin Haney specifically, the next story made it look like he was taking shots at Haney. “Now go back and read it one more time and let it sink in,” noted Ellis. We have not seen ‘The Dream’ in action since the fight and the reports suggesting a broken jaw were rampant at the time.
Furthermore, the Haneys have expressed their desire to get back into the ring. However, there has been no confirmation from either the father or the son regarding the reason for his inactivity.
